Local residents are advised to take note of the Cup Match holiday changes in garbage and recycling collection next week.
A spokeswoman for Public Works said in the west end garbage will be collected this Monday, July 31st. Recyclables and garbage will also be collected on Wednesday, August 1st.
East end garbage will be collected on Tuesday, August 1st, recyclables and garbage will be collected again on Saturday, August 5th.
“When enjoying Bermuda’s outdoor environment this holiday season please remember to practice pack-in-pack-out; bring your own waste and recycling bags and take home for disposal on your regular collection days instead of leaving it at public docks, beaches and parks,” she added.
